#494d05 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#494d05 is composed of 28.6% red, 30.2% green and 2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 5.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 93.5% yellow and 69.8% black. It has a hue angle of 63.3 degrees, a saturation of 87.8% and a lightness of 16.1%. #494d05 color hex could be obtained by blending #929a0a with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336600.

Shades and Tints of #494d05

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030300 is the darkest color, while #fdfef0 is the lightest one.

Tones of #494d05

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#2a2a28 is the less saturated color, while #4c5002 is the most saturated one.
